Concise Synthesis of Cyclic Ethers via the Palladium-Catalyzed
Coupling of Ketene Acetal Triflates and Organozinc Reagents.
Application to the Iterative Synthesis of Polycyclic Ethers
posted on 2002-04-25, 00:00authored byIsao Kadota, Hiroyoshi Takamura, Kumi Sato, Yoshinori Yamamoto
The reaction of the ketene acetal triflates 9a−e and a zinc homoenolate 10 in the presence of a
catalytic amount of Pd(PPh3)4 gave the enol ethers 11a−e in good yields. The products were
converted to the corresponding cyclic ethers 14a and 14b by hydroboration and lactonization. The
present methodology allowed us to synthesize the DE and GH ring segment of gambierol in a concise
manner. Iterative syntheses of the polycyclic ethers 26 and 32 are also described.
